How much do visual designer intern j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for visual designer intern in Cape Cod, MA is $20.77,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.48 and $23.17 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a Visual Designer Intern do?

A Visual Designer Intern assists in creating engaging visual concepts for digital and print media, such as websites, social media, advertisements, and branding materials. They work closely with senior designers and other team members to produce graphics, layouts, and illustrations that align with a company's brand guidelines. Visual Designer Interns often use design software like Adobe Creative Suite and gain hands-on experience in real-world projects. Their responsibilities may also include revising designs based on feedback and preparing files for production.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Visual Designer Intern?

To thrive as a Visual Designer Intern, you need a solid grasp of design principles, proficiency in graphic design, and a relevant portfolio or coursework in visual arts or design. Familiarity with industry-standard tools such as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ign) and prototyping platforms like Figma or Sketch is typically expected. Strong collaboration, openness to feedback, and effective communication distinguish outstanding interns in this role. These skills ensure the intern can create visually engaging work, integrate with creative teams, and contribute to impactful design solutions.

How does a Visual Designer Intern typically collaborate with other team members during projects?

As a Visual Designer Intern, you'll often work closely with UX designers, developers, and project managers to bring creative concepts to life. Collaboration usually involves participating in brainstorming sessions, receiving and incorporating feedback on design drafts, and ensuring your visual assets align with brand guidelines. You may also attend team meetings to discuss project timelines and hand off designs to developers for implementation. This role offers a great opportunity to build communication skills and learn how design fits into the broader product development process.

What is the difference between Visual Designer Intern vs Graphic Design Intern?

AspectVisual Designer InternGraphic Design Intern
Required SkillsDesign software, visual storytelling, brandingDesign software, layout, branding
Work EnvironmentCreative teams, marketing, digital mediaAdvertising agencies, marketing teams, print media
Industry UsageTech, media, advertising, digital productsPrint, advertising, branding, marketing

Both roles involve design skills and work in creative environments, but a Visual Designer Intern typically focuses on visual storytelling and digital media, while a Graphic Design Intern often emphasizes print and branding projects. The roles overlap in skills and industry usage, but the focus areas differ slightly, making the comparison useful for those exploring design internships.

Content & Design Studio Internship: Design & Visual Art Intern
Time Commitment: 20-32 hours/week from September 15 - December 17, 2026 @ $15 per hour.
CONNELLY CONTENT STUDIO:

We make stuff. Social stuff. Timely stuff. Stuff people WANT in their feeds.
Not ads preaching. But authentic content. Sometimes useful. Sometimes funny. Always relevant.
We entertain, delight and educate on behalf of the brands we serve.
We're scrappy. We write, design, shoot, edit, and animate stuff ourselves.
We're ideas first, make it second. We try stuff with no fear of failure.
Because the more we try, the more we learn. Together.
We are the CP Content & Design Studio.
A nimble and hungry creative intern specializing in design, photography, video, and visual arts.
Our goal is to make ads and social content for brands that will resonate with their target audience.
And have a blast in the process.
JOB PURPOSE
As a Content & Design Studio intern, you'll join the creative team to work on designs, create content and play a role in the entire production process. With guidance and mentorship from the Design Studio Director, you'll collaborate with other members of the creative department to create compelling concepts, meaningful connections and relevant and innovative work while gaining hands-on experience working on several established brand clients.
ESSENTIAL JOB DUTIES
Ensure the creative vision and look and feel is implemented
Assist in the development of ideas that stem from empathetic insights, cultural observations and timely social topics of discussions
Work with writers, photographers, videographers, other members of the team to frame your ideas
Concept and design across a variety of platforms
Present your own ideas with confidence
QUALIFICATIONS
Currently enrolled in an art direction/advertising or design program
Facility with all media (print, social, online, radio, possibly even TV); understanding of digital development while working on platforms is a plus
In tune to current cultural design trends
Conceptual thinker who is able to think both in terms of words and visuals and how they work together to solve real marketing problems
Excited to bring many ideas forward and see them through
Team player
Ability to balance multiple projects
Proficient in Adobe Creative Suite
